Suppose reactant A reacts with reactant B to form product C according to the balanced equation A + B ⟶ C . If you react 3 moles of reactant A with 1 moles of reactant B, what will be present after the reaction

If you react 3 moles of reactant A with 1 moles of reactant B, 2 moles of reactant A will be remaining.

From the question given above, the balanced equation for the reaction between reactant A and B is given below:

A + B —> C

1   :  1

3  :  1

From the balanced equation above,

1 mole of A reacted with 1 mole of B.

Therefore,

3 moles of A will also react with 3 moles of B.

Thus, B is the limiting reactant and A is the excess reactant.

Finally, we shall determine amount of A remaining.

Amount of A given = 3 moles

Amount of A that reacted = 1 mole

Amount of A remaining =?

Amount of A remaining = (Amount of A given) – (Amount of A that reacted)

Amount of A remaining = 3 – 1

Amount of A remaining = 2 moles

Therefore, 2 moles of reactant A will remain if 3 moles of reactant A with 1 moles of reactant B.
